How the smart watch wake up sleep cycle works

The smart watch wake up sleep cycle uses nightly Sleep data to time wake events and notifications. Instead of a fixed alarm, the device looks for windows where you are in light sleep or near waking, then gently vibrates or displays a subtle alarm. This approach aims to reduce grogginess and help you start the day more alert. In practice, the watch uses a combination of sensors—the accelerometer to track movement, heart rate and heart rate variability to infer sleep stages, and light or skin sensors to detect environment and readiness. While accuracy varies by device and your bedtime routine, most watches learn your patterns over days or weeks and adjust wake times accordingly. According to Smartwatch Facts, these wake prompts are now common in mainstream wearables and are increasingly personalized. The core idea is simple: wake you when your brain is closer to waking, not in the middle of deep sleep. What exactly is the smart watch wake up sleep cycle?

The wake up sleep cycle is a feature that times alarms based on estimated sleep stages, aiming to wake you during lighter sleep rather than deep sleep. It relies on sensors and patterns learned over time.

How accurate is sleep tracking on smartwatches?

Accuracy varies by device and usage. Watches estimate sleep stages from movement and heart data, which is not medical-grade but useful for identifying patterns and trends over weeks.

Can wake up alarms disturb sleep if the device misreads?

Yes, sensor misreads can lead to waking at suboptimal times. Most devices offer a fallback traditional alarm and allow you to adjust wake windows.

Should I wear the watch all night for best results?

Wearing the watch overnight improves data quality and wake alarm timing. Ensure a comfortable fit and charged battery to avoid interruptions.
